How To Play
Start by steering your car left or right to line up with vehicles that match your current color. When you merge with the correct car, your speed increases, giving you more distance from the police. Avoid cars of different colors, as they won’t help you and can slow your progress. Keep an eye on upcoming traffic so you can position yourself early instead of swerving at the last second. The longer you maintain your speed through successful merges, the better your chances of escaping the chase.
Controls
Desktop:
- A / D or Left / Right Arrow Keys – Move the car
- M – Toggle music
- R – Restart the game if you get stuck
Mobile / Touch Devices:
- Tap the left or right side of the screen to steer
Gameplay Experience
The gameplay revolves around reading traffic quickly and making smart merges. When two cars of the same color line up, merging them gives you a burst of speed. That boost is essential—without it, the police slowly gain ground. As traffic becomes denser, deciding which lane to commit to becomes more important than pure reflexes.
What stands out is how the game forces you to think ahead. A bad merge or a moment of hesitation can cost you valuable momentum. The challenge builds naturally, making each escape attempt feel like a small test of focus and planning rather than random chaos.

Tips for New Players
Try to plan merges early rather than reacting at the last moment. Maintaining speed early makes later sections more manageable. If a run goes wrong, restarting quickly helps you learn traffic patterns and improve your timing on the next attempt.
